Transaction 3389114d9c705824d51b58d8fbe135707c7a8fb9c03544f50158ac9e31ae9fb2

1 Input
2 Outputs
  • 3389114d9c705824d51b58d8fbe135707c7a8fb9c03544f50158ac9e31ae9fb2:0
  • value  5908520675
    address  2NCjvmzuNB9NF1TG4JDibtuQWfRgKTRg8eg
  • 3389114d9c705824d51b58d8fbe135707c7a8fb9c03544f50158ac9e31ae9fb2:1
  • value  1652892
    address  2Msruwmjg9PYW25Pyusy2hSpHLFgvy3Fs5R